1. Whimsical Balloon Arches and Garlands
Seriously, is there anything a good balloon arch can’t fix? These aren’t your childhood party balloons; we’re talking organic, multi-sized, color-coordinated masterpieces that scream “effortlessly chic.” They create an instant focal point and make for epic photo backdrops.
Pro tip: Mix in some artificial greenery or small floral accents for an extra touch of sophistication. It elevates the whole look from “party store” to “pinterest perfect.” They’re super versatile and can match literally any theme.
2. The Epic Diaper Cake Extravaganza
Who knew something so practical could be so darn cute? A multi-tiered diaper cake is not just a decoration; it’s a gift in disguise. Stack those diapers high and adorn them with ribbons, tiny toys, and maybe even a pacifier or two.
It’s the ultimate centerpiece that guests will actually talk about, and the parents-to-be will absolutely appreciate every single diaper. Pro tip: Stick to neutral colors for the diapers themselves, then go wild with your theme’s colors in the ribbons and embellishments.
3. “Oh Baby” Letter Balloons
Sometimes, less is more, especially when it’s spelled out in giant, shiny balloons. These are a no-brainer for adding a festive, celebratory vibe without overcrowding the space. Hang them above the gift table or as a backdrop for the main event.
They’re simple, effective, and instantly convey the joyous occasion. Pro tip: Opt for gold or rose gold for a touch of glam, or pastel shades for a softer, more traditional look. They make every photo pop.
4. Themed Dessert Table Delights
Your dessert table isn’t just for snacks; it’s a prime decorating opportunity. Think beyond just cupcakes. Use risers, cute serving dishes, and small themed props to create a cohesive, delectable display.
Coordinate your treats with your chosen color palette or theme for a truly immersive experience. Pro tip: Add a small banner or a framed sign with a cute baby-related phrase to really tie the whole sweet scene together.
5. Lush Floral Arrangements (Faux or Fresh)
Flowers always bring a touch of elegance, no matter the occasion. Whether you splurge on fresh blooms or go for high-quality faux arrangements, they add life and color to any space. Think beyond just centerpieces; use them on gift tables, food stations, or even restrooms.
They instantly elevate the atmosphere, making everything feel a bit more special. Pro tip: Incorporate baby’s breath for an extra sweet, delicate touch that perfectly suits a baby shower. It’s affordable and adorable.
6. Interactive Photo Booth Backdrop
Give your guests something fun to do (besides eating all the tiny sandwiches). A dedicated photo booth area with a cute backdrop and some props encourages interaction and captures priceless memories. Think fringe curtains, a flower wall, or even a simple fabric drape.
It provides entertainment and ensures everyone goes home with a fun keepsake. Pro tip: Include a few baby-themed props like oversized pacifiers, baby bonnets, or speech bubbles with cute phrases.
7. Adorable Baby Clothesline Decor
This is peak cuteness and surprisingly easy to DIY. Hang a string or ribbon across a wall or window and clip on tiny baby onesies, socks, and hats. It’s charming, personal, and a great way to showcase some of those adorable baby clothes.
It adds a handmade, heartfelt touch that guests will adore. Pro tip: Use clothes in your theme colors or patterns, and maybe even include a few outfits the parents-to-be have already picked out.
8. Personalized Welcome Sign
Make a grand first impression right at the door. A beautifully designed welcome sign, customized with the baby’s name (if known) or a sweet message, sets the tone for the entire event. Use a chalkboard, a framed print, or even a wooden board.
It instantly makes guests feel invited and excited for the celebration ahead. Pro tip: Add a small floral arrangement or some balloons around the sign to make it even more eye-catching.
9. Centerpieces Featuring Baby Items
Why buy generic centerpieces when you can use items the baby will actually need? Fill small baskets or decorative boxes with baby bottles, pacifiers, rattles, or tiny stuffed animals.
It’s functional decor that doubles as a gift or can be given to the parents after the shower. Pro tip: Arrange items aesthetically, using varying heights and textures, and tie with a pretty ribbon for a polished look.
10. Sweet Book-Themed Decor
If the parents-to-be are bookworms, lean into a literary theme. Decorate with classic children’s books, create a “library” corner, or use book pages as bunting. Ask guests to bring a book instead of a card.
It’s a charming, thoughtful theme that encourages a love of reading from day one. Pro tip: Stack books of varying sizes and colors to create interesting visual displays on tables or shelves.
11. Dreamy Starry Night or Cloud Theme
For a truly ethereal and gender-neutral vibe, a starry night or cloud theme is perfection. Think soft blues, grays, and whites, with twinkle lights, cotton ball clouds, and star cutouts. It creates a serene and magical atmosphere.
It’s wonderfully calming and universally appealing for welcoming a new little one. Pro tip: Hang paper lanterns painted to look like moons or stars for an extra whimsical touch.
12. Playful Safari or Jungle Adventure
Unleash the wild side with a safari or jungle theme. Think plush animal toys, leafy green garlands, and earthy tones. It’s vibrant, fun, and offers endless possibilities for creative decorations.
This theme is fantastic for a lively, adventurous celebration. Pro tip: Use animal print balloons or tablecloths subtly to tie the theme together without overwhelming the space.
13. Whimsical Hot Air Balloon Mobiles
Elevate your decor (literally!) with hot air balloon mobiles. You can make them using paper lanterns or small baskets with balloons, hanging them from the ceiling at various heights. They add a magical, dreamy quality.
They’re unique and create a wonderful sense of wonder and adventure. Pro tip: Incorporate small stuffed animals peeking out of the baskets for an extra adorable touch.
14. Customized Banners and Buntings
Personalize your space with banners or buntings that spell out “Baby [Last Name],” “Welcome Little One,” or even the baby’s name. You can buy them pre-made or get crafty with cardstock and ribbon.
They add a personal touch that shows you put thought into the celebration. Pro tip: Mix different textures like burlap, fabric, or glitter cardstock for a more dynamic look.
15. Gorgeous Sweet Treat Bar
Beyond the main dessert table, a dedicated sweet treat bar can be both decorative and delicious. Think jars filled with candies, cookies, or mini pastries, all artfully arranged. Use apothecary jars and cute scoops.
It’s visually appealing and gives guests another delightful area to explore. Pro tip: Label each treat with a cute, themed name like “Ready to Pop” popcorn or “Sweet Pea” jelly beans.
